API is first-class, discoverable, versioned, documented. MessagePack structured communication enables extensions in any language. Remote plugins run as co-processes, safely and asynchronously. GUIs, IDEs, web browsers can, embed Neovim as an editor or script host. Works the same everywhere, one build-type, one command. Modern terminal features such as cursor styling, focus events, bracketed paste. Built-in terminal emulator and strong defaults. Fully compatible with Vim's editing model and Vimscript v1. Start with :help nvim-from-vim if you already use Vim. The current stable release version is 0.5 (RSS). See the roadmap for progress and plans. With 30% less source-code than Vim, the vision of Neovim is to enable new applications without compromising Vim's traditional roles. Lua is built-in, but Vimscript is supported with the most advanced Vimscript engine in the world (featuring an AST-producing parser).

UltraEdit is a text and code editor built for work that general-purpose editors often struggle with: large files, complex data manipulation, and security-sensitive workflows. It has been in the market for more than 30 years, is used by over 4 million users worldwide, and is trusted by enterprise customers across the Fortune 100, 500, and 1000. Individual users choose UltraEdit when everyday editors start to hit their limits. Common use cases include working with very large files, running advanced search and replace, using column and block editing, and handling more complex text and data manipulation. Organizations choose UltraEdit when they need a more secure and supportable editor behind sensitive workflows. That includes teams in banking, insurance, healthcare, government, and other regulated or risk-sensitive environments where unsupported tools can create too much uncertainty.

  • I used it to develop Java and c++. I loved the speed and flexibility and the fact that no mouse is needed and you can have a very fast and efficient workflow using the keyboard with easy to remember neumonic s (like SF to search files) rather than holding down lots of different modifiers that are hard to remember. The editor is the focus and temporary popups are used for searching for things, call hierarchy, errors etc so you aren't rearranging splitter positions all the time. The errors were shown instantly as I typed and I could even launch my application when while it had compile errors and my refactoring was not finished. Much better than the workflow in intellij for example.

Cons

  • There is some investment time needed to learn it initially but the power and flexibility it gives you is worth it in the end.
